Performance Incentives and Bonuses
Beyond base salaries, NFL contracts often include a variety of performance incentives and bonuses—the icing on the cake, if you will. These can range from achieving specific statistical milestones (e.g., number of tackles, interceptions, or sacks) to team-based achievements (e.g., making the playoffs, winning a Super Bowl). For a player like Kevin Johnson, who consistently performed well, these incentives could truly move the needle, adding a substantial amount to his annual income.
These bonuses are specifically designed to motivate players and reward exceptional performance. While not always guaranteed, successfully meeting these benchmarks can significantly inflate an athlete’s yearly earnings, making a game-changer for their accumulated wealth. It’s important to consider these variable components when calculating an athlete’s total financial gains from their playing career.

Strategies for Long-Term Wealth Preservation
Long-term wealth preservation for NFL athletes involves more than one trick up their sleeve; it’s a multi-faceted approach. This includes creating diversified investment portfolios, establishing robust retirement accounts, and setting up trusts or other financial vehicles. The overarching goal is to make sure their money works for them, ensuring that the wealth accumulated during their playing career lasts well into retirement and can potentially be passed down to future generations.
Common strategies include:
- Diversified Investment Portfolios: Spreading investments across various asset classes (stocks, bonds, real estate) to mitigate risk.
- Retirement Planning: Maxing out contributions to 401(k)s, IRAs, and other retirement accounts.
- Insurance: Obtaining appropriate life, disability, and health insurance to protect assets and income.
- Budgeting and Expense Management: Developing a clear understanding of income and expenditures to avoid overspending.
These strategies are crucial for building a solid financial safety net and maintaining a healthy financial standing long after their playing days are over.

Methodology for Net Worth Calculation
Taking a stab at estimating an individual’s net worth, especially a public figure like Kevin Johnson, involves a careful aggregation of various financial components. The basic formula for net worth is quite simple: Assets – Liabilities. Assets include career earnings, property values, investment portfolios, and business stakes. Liabilities, on the other hand, encompass debts such as mortgages, loans, and other financial obligations.
For athletes, publicly available data primarily covers career earnings from contracts and some endorsement deals, which is often just the tip of the iceberg. However, private investments, real estate values, and personal debts are typically kept under wraps and not disclosed. Therefore, any published net worth figure is often an informed estimate based on available information and industry benchmarks for similar athletes, and should generally be taken with a grain of salt.
